May Day, also known as International Workers’ Day, is celebrated annually on May 1st. It’s a day that has been observed for over a century and is recognized as a public holiday in many countries. While it’s traditionally a day to recognize the achievements of the labor movement, it’s also a day that can improve your well-being in many ways. Connect with others
May Day celebrations often involve community gatherings and parades. Participating in these events can be a great way to connect with others in your community and build new relationships. Social connections are an essential part of well-being, and having a strong support system can help you manage stress and cope with challenges.
Get outdoors
May Day celebrations are often held outdoors, which means you’ll have the opportunity to get some fresh air and sunshine. Spending time in nature has been shown to reduce stress, improve mood, and increase feelings of well-being. Take advantage of the chance to enjoy the outdoors and soak up some Vitamin D.
Engage in physical activity
Many May Day celebrations involve physical activity, such as dancing or participating in a parade. Engaging in physical activity has numerous benefits for your physical and mental health, including reducing the risk of chronic diseases, improving sleep, and reducing stress and anxiety.
Learn something new
May Day celebrations often include educational activities, such as talks and workshops. Learning something new can be a great way to boost your self-esteem, increase your knowledge, and stimulate your mind.
Celebrate accomplishments
May Day is a day to celebrate the accomplishments of workers and the labor movement. Take some time to reflect on your own accomplishments and celebrate your own hard work. Celebrating your accomplishments can boost your self-esteem and help you feel more confident in your abilities.
